Responsibilities The Department of Digital Art and Design at NYIT is seeking an adjunct faculty member to teach Motion Graphics I, an introductory studio course focused on motion design fundamentals, animation principles, and professional workflows for broadcast, digital media, and branded content. Students will explore time-based design using typography, imagery, and sequential storytelling. The course emphasizes the use of industry-standard tools and techniques, guiding students through a step-by-step production process-beginning with storyboarding and concept development, and moving through animation, sound, and final delivery. Assignments are modeled on real-world creative briefs to prepare students for professional practice. We are looking for candidates with strong professional experience in the motion graphics industry who can guide students through the contemporary production pipeline. The course should reflect current trends in branding, advertising, entertainment, and digital platforms, while helping students develop both creative fluency and technical proficiency. Qualifications Bachelor’s degree in Motion Design, Animation, Graphic Design, or related field; Master’s degree preferred. Minimum 5 years of professional experience in motion graphics, animation, or digital storytellin.g
Proven ability to work within motion pipelines including storyboard development, animatics, keyframing, compositing, and platform-based delivery.
Expert-level proficiency in Adobe After Effects; strong knowledge of Illustrator, Photoshop, Premiere; experience with Cinema 4D or Blender is a plus.
Familiarity with AI-assisted motion tools, dynamic design systems, or data-driven animation workflows is preferred.
Excellent critique, mentoring, and communication skills.
